> On Thu, 2008-05-01 at 12:12 -0700, > [EMAIL PROTECTED] wrote: > > > > I'm not familiar with ddwrt but your dhcp server needs to provide at > > least three things to your pxe clients: next-server, filename and > > root-path. From your original post it appears that pxelinux.0 is your > > filename, 192.168.1.5 is your next-server, but you didn't list a > > root-path. I imagine this value will vary by setup. Ubuntu uses > > /opt/ltsp/i386 by default. > > Dave just a point because its confusing to those-who-look-here > > UBUNTU LTSP5 does not use root path! It uses nbd to serve a squash > image. > > James >
